Role: 1st Line IT Engineer

Location: Southampton (Hybrid Working)

Salary: £25,000 - £28,000

Fast-Growing Telecom Provider | Cloud & Networking Exposure | Clear Career Progression

We’re partnered with a growing telecoms service provider based in Southampton that is continuing to expand its technology and support teams as demand for their services increases. Known for delivering reliable connectivity and modern communication solutions to businesses across the UK, they’re now looking for an enthusiastic 1st Line IT Engineer to join their expanding technical support team.

This is a fantastic opportunity for someone early in their IT career who wants to develop their technical skills in a fast-paced technology environment. You’ll be the first point of contact for technical issues, supporting users across a range of systems while gaining valuable exposure to networking, cloud services, and telecom infrastructure.

What makes this role particularly exciting is the clear progression pathway within the technical team. You’ll work closely with experienced engineers, assisting with escalations and learning about more advanced infrastructure and networking technologies as you grow. For someone motivated to build a long-term career in IT, this role offers the chance to progress into 2nd Line, Network Engineering, or Infrastructure roles over time.

Required Skills:

  • Experience supporting Windows environments and Microsoft 365
  • Basic understanding of Active Directory and user administration
  • Knowledge of networking fundamentals (DNS, DHCP, VPNs)
  •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ills
  • Excellent communication and customer support skills
  • A genuine interest in technology, networking, and telecom systems

Exclusive Benefits:

  • £25,000 - £28,000 Salary
  • Hybrid Working Model
  • Exposure to networking, telecom infrastructure, and cloud technologies
  • Work alongside a skilled and supportive technical team
  • Clear progression pathway into 2nd Line, Networking, or Infrastructure roles
  • Training and certification opportunities
  • Modern and collaborative working environment
  • 25 Days Holiday + Bank Holidays

How to prepare for a job interview at Sterling Bridge Limited

✨Know Your Tech Basics

Brush up on your knowledge of Windows environments, Microsoft 365, and networking fundamentals like DNS and DHCP. Being able to discuss these topics confidently will show that you're ready for the role and can handle the technical challenges that come your way.

✨Show Off Your Problem-Solving Skills

Prepare to share examples of how you've tackled technical issues in the past. Think of specific scenarios where you identified a problem, worked through it, and resolved it. This will demonstrate your troubleshooting abilities and your approach to customer support.

✨Communicate Clearly

Since you'll be the first point of contact for users, practice explaining technical concepts in simple terms. During the interview, focus on clear communication and active listening to show that you can effectively support users with varying levels of tech knowledge.

✨Express Your Enthusiasm for Growth

Let them know you're eager to learn and grow within the company. Talk about your interest in networking, cloud services, and telecom systems, and how you see this role as a stepping stone to further your career in IT. This will highlight your motivation and commitment to the position.
